Output 38792b54a54481696182ec010f2101ceb9152bd3e2b0e67f9dd1e3ebd5c39701:3

value
791425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b762922af6f9736dc4be3aecc9ea704d27553c0 OP_EQUAL
address
3A2cxwychiqkEUSmyEv2ExhKFzvLuN4QXd
transaction
38792b54a54481696182ec010f2101ceb9152bd3e2b0e67f9dd1e3ebd5c39701
spent
true